Mel's Big Decision and Her Lingering Grief
At the heart of Virgin River is Mel Monroe, a nurse practitioner with a past as complicated as a tangled fishing line. In this episode, Mel grapples with the monumental decision of whether to stay in Virgin River or return to her life in Los Angeles. Her initial move to the small town was an attempt to escape the pain of losing her husband, Mark. However, Virgin River, with its quirky residents and undeniable charm, has slowly started to chip away at her grief. The ruggedly handsome Jack Sheridan has also played a significant role in her potential new beginning.
Throughout the season, we've seen Mel struggle with flashbacks and memories of Mark. In "Unexpected Endings," these memories become even more poignant as she realizes that running away from her past isn't the answer. She needs to confront her grief head-on, and perhaps, just perhaps, Virgin River can be the place where she finally heals. The episode beautifully portrays her internal conflict, showcasing her vulnerability and resilience. The final moments, where she makes a pivotal decision, leave us wondering if love and a fresh start are truly within her reach. Jack's Complicated Love Life and Charmaine's Bombshell
Ah, Jack Sheridan, the owner of the local bar and a man with a heart as big as the surrounding redwood trees. But, let's be honest, his love life is a mess! Just as things are heating up between Jack and Mel, Charmaine drops a bombshell – she's pregnant, and Jack is the father! Talk about an "Unexpected Ending," right? This revelation throws a major wrench into Jack and Mel's budding romance. Jack, ever the honorable guy, is now faced with the responsibility of fatherhood with a woman he doesn't love. This creates a complex dynamic, forcing him to navigate his feelings for Mel while also supporting Charmaine through her pregnancy. The episode masterfully portrays Jack's internal struggle, showcasing his loyalty and his longing for a genuine connection with Mel. Martin Henderson delivers a compelling performance, capturing the nuances of Jack's character with authenticity. The tension between Jack, Mel, and Charmaine is palpable, creating a dramatic love triangle that will undoubtedly play out in future seasons. This storyline highlights the complexities of relationships and the unexpected turns that life can take. It also raises questions about duty, love, and the sacrifices we make for the sake of family.
Hope and Doc: A Relationship Tested
Hope and Doc, the town's resident bickering couple, have a relationship that's as enduring as the ancient trees surrounding Virgin River. However, their bond is tested in this episode when secrets from Doc's past come to light. We learn more about Doc's history and the reasons behind his gruff exterior. Hope, as always, is fiercely loyal and supportive, but even her patience is pushed to its limits. The episode delves into the complexities of long-term relationships, exploring themes of forgiveness, acceptance, and the importance of communication. Annette O'Toole and Tim Matheson deliver stellar performances, bringing depth and nuance to their characters. Their interactions are both humorous and heartwarming, providing a welcome balance to the drama unfolding elsewhere in the episode. The storyline also serves as a reminder that even the strongest relationships can be challenged by the weight of the past, but with understanding and compassion, they can endure. It leaves us wondering if Hope and Doc can truly overcome these obstacles and rebuild their relationship stronger than before.
The Undercurrent of Crime and Brady's Involvement
Let's not forget the undercurrent of crime that runs through Virgin River. Brady, Jack's former Marine buddy, is still entangled in some shady dealings, and his actions have consequences for everyone in town. In this episode, we see the darker side of Virgin River, as Brady's involvement with illegal activities puts him and those around him in danger. The episode raises questions about loyalty, redemption, and the choices we make that define our lives. Brady's character is complex, torn between his friendship with Jack and his allegiance to a dangerous world. His storyline adds a layer of suspense and intrigue to the series, reminding us that even in the most idyllic settings, darkness can lurk beneath the surface. It also serves as a cautionary tale about the dangers of getting involved in criminal activities and the far-reaching consequences they can have.
